Financial results: Deutsche Beteiliungs AG, New Energies Invest AG
New Energies Invest AG has reported that its net asset value (NAV) fell to SFr 184.65 (EUR 126.11) during the second quarter of 2002, that is 1.3% over the quarter and 1.9% over the year 2002 to the end of June. Total assets were SFr 49.85m (EUR 34.05m) of which 64.8% or SFr 32.29m (EUR 22.05m) were invested.
